Recognizing Probiotics
Probiotics are real-time bacteria, primarily microorganisms and yeast, that give health benefits when eaten in sufficient amounts. They are usually described as "great" or "pleasant" germs since they aid preserve a healthy equilibrium of microorganisms in the gut. In canines, as in human beings, a well balanced gut microbiome is critical for general health and health.

The Function of Probiotics in Canine Health And Wellness
The gut microbiome contains trillions of bacteria that play a vital function in various physical functions, consisting of digestion, immune feedback, and nutrient absorption. Probiotics assistance keep this delicate equilibrium by renewing beneficial microorganisms and avoiding the overgrowth of unsafe bacteria. Below are some essential benefits of probiotics for dogs:

Digestive Health and wellness: Probiotics can help manage and protect against intestinal concerns such as diarrhea, constipation, and bloating. They advertise normal bowel movements and boost nutrient absorption.
Immune System Assistance: A healthy digestive tract is very closely linked to a durable immune system. Probiotics can improve your pet's immune reaction, making them a lot more resilient to infections and diseases.
Allergic Reaction Relief: Probiotics might aid reduce signs of allergic reactions by modulating the body immune system and lowering inflammation.
Skin and Coat Wellness: By promoting a healthy digestive tract, probiotics can additionally improve the condition of your pet's skin and coat, decreasing problems such as irritation, dryness, and dropping.
Behavior Advantages: Emerging research suggests a link in between gut health and wellness and habits. Probiotics could help in reducing anxiety and anxiety in pet dogs, adding to better overall habits.
Kinds of Probiotics for Dogs
Numerous pressures of probiotics are commonly used in canine supplements. Each stress uses one-of-a-kind advantages, and a combination of different strains can offer detailed assistance for your pet's wellness. Several of the most commonly used probiotic stress for canines include:

Lactobacillus acidophilus: This stress assists preserve a healthy and balanced equilibrium of microorganisms in the gut and can assist in food digestion and nutrient absorption.
Bifidobacterium animalis: Recognized for its capacity to boost intestine wellness, this pressure can aid take care of looseness of the bowels and boost total digestive system feature.
Enterococcus faecium: This pressure sustains a healthy and balanced intestine microbiome and can aid protect against and take care of stomach problems.
Saccharomyces boulardii: A valuable yeast, S. boulardii, can aid take care of looseness of the bowels and advertise digestive tract health and wellness by stopping the overgrowth of hazardous bacteria.
Choosing the Right Probiotic Supplement
When selecting probiotics for pets, it is vital to take into consideration numerous aspects to ensure you are offering the best item for your pet dog:

Quality and Pureness: Select probiotics from trusted brands that use high-quality active ingredients and comply with great manufacturing techniques. Try to find products that are free from artificial additives, fillers, and chemicals.
Pressure Diversity: A good probiotic supplement needs to consist of several strains of valuable germs to offer comprehensive assistance for your canine's gut wellness.
CFU Count: Colony-forming units (CFUs) show the number of live microbes in a probiotic supplement. A higher CFU count can improve the effectiveness of the supplement. Seek items with at least 1 billion CFUs per offering.
Type and Administration: Probiotics for pet dogs come in numerous types, including powders, pills, chews, and liquids. Pick a form that is very easy to provide and suits your pet dog's preferences.
Storage Space and Shelf Life: Some probiotics call for refrigeration to maintain their effectiveness, while others are shelf-stable. Comply with the storage space directions on the item label to make certain the probiotics stay effective.
Exactly How to Administer Probiotics to Your Pet dog
Carrying out probiotics to your pet dog is straightforward, yet there are a few pointers to guarantee the most effective results:

Adhere To the Dosage Recommendations: Always comply with the advised dosage guidelines on the product tag or as suggested by your veterinarian. Overdosing can bring about gastrointestinal distress, while underdosing might not offer the wanted benefits.
Uniformity is Key: To preserve a healthy digestive tract microbiome, it is necessary to give probiotics constantly. Carry out the supplement at the same time daily, ideally with dishes to enhance absorption.
Screen Your Pet: Observe your dog for any type of adjustments in their health and habits after beginning probiotics. Seek improvements in digestion, layer problem, and overall wellness. If you see any unfavorable responses, consult your vet.
Possible Side Effects
Probiotics are typically taken into consideration secure for dogs, however like any type of supplement, they can create negative effects in some cases. Typical adverse effects consist of:

Light Indigestion: Some dogs may experience short-term digestion concerns such as gas, bloating, or looseness of the bowels when first starting probiotics. These symptoms typically diminish as your pet dog's system readjusts.
Allergies: Although uncommon, some pets may have an allergic reaction to certain probiotic strains or ingredients in the supplement. If you discover indications of an allergic reaction, such as itchiness, swelling, or problem breathing, terminate usage and consult your vet.
